Dr.
Sinclair Ferguson serves as a Professor of Systematic Theology at
Westminster Theological Seminary's Dallas, Texas campus. Dr.
Ferguson has been a Visiting Professor of Systematic Theology with
Westminster for many years and serves as an editor with the Banner of
Truth Trust. In addition, he previously served as a full time
professor at the Philadelphia campus until taking a call to St.
George’s Tron Church in Glasgow, Scotland in 1998. He studied at the
University of Aberdeen for his M.A., B.D., and Ph.D. degrees, was
ordained in the Church of Scotland in 1971, and served in pastoral
ministry in Scotland from 1971-1982.
